Constantine is a family owned international art logistics company for private collectors, museums and galleries. With over 140 years’ experience and worldwide recognition in fine art transportation, Constantine combines unrivalled knowledge and expertise with latest technical innovation in secure storage and project management. We are currently recruiting for a Warehouse Technician to join us based at our Coatbridge warehouse. The ideal candidate will have experience in a busy warehouse, loading and unloading trucks. Main responsibilities: Hands on artwork and object handling and packing, loading and unloading of vehicles Handling crates, pallets, soft wrapped objects and objects of all sizes with extreme care and precision Ensuring the safe unloading of incoming or loading of outgoing shipments and maintaining the chain of custody whilst adhering to regulations and company policies Making sure all jobs on the Warehouse Management System (LEO) are fully utilised and any movements are logged and recorded correctly in line with company protocols Maintaining and promoting a high level of security and confidentiality at all times Maintaining the warehouse environment to the highest of standards Inventory checking & auditing Liaising with co-ordinators when queries arise regarding items received and released, investigating any discrepancies such as size, weight, condition/damage, additional pieces or packing. Highlighting and rectifying any errors identified on incoming works such as missing object labels, incorrect or missing paperwork to managers and coordinators Preparing all outgoing deliveries ahead of time in the correct area with correct paperwork Checking and maintaining manual handling equipment and reporting any defects Administrative tasks where required, such as checking transport slips Other ad hoc duties as required Art Handling training will be provided Working Hours: Flexible hours, 9 hour shift, Monday - Friday Core hours generally but flexibility is required within the above hours to cover any early or late requirements within operations Overtime will be required as part of the role Requirements: Relevant experience High attention to detail Good maths and literacy skills Excellent customer service skills Experience using a PC/Laptop, Hand Held Terminals and Microsoft IT packages.
